It’s Victory Day for Belgium! After two defections against Holland and Georgia, the Devils take on Portugal this Tuesday at 6 p.m. In addition to aiming to win their first Euro Espoirs game for sixteen years, the young Belgians will want to validate their ticket to the quarter-finals. And to achieve this goal, one victory is enough.

But share will not destroy it Jackie Mathisen’s Men. For this, Georgia must beat the Netherlands (a match that also takes place at 6 pm). In the event of a split between the Georgians and the Dutch, our compatriots should score more goals than the Portuguese.

In return, Belgium will be eliminated in case of defeat.

Luis Obenda found himself facing an almost empty goal, after only a minute of play, having been made up by Baliquecha, his shot finishing on the post. The Lens striker should have opened the scoring for the Belgians.
